Questões de Concurso Comentadas para analista de ti

Foram encontradas 827 questões

Resolva questões gratuitamente!

Junte-se a mais de 4 milhões de concurseiros!

Q1919449 Governança de TI
Sobre os modelos PMI/PMBOK, Cobit e ITIL, marque à alternativa INCORRETA.
Alternativas
Q1919447 Governança de TI
Nos dias de hoje, o que se observa é a incapacidade das empresas em desenvolver software com qualidade, de acordo com os requisitos estabelecidos no projeto e dentro do prazo estimado. As empresas precisam cada vez mais, oferecer produtos e serviços que satisfaçam a qualidade exigida pelo cliente. Os modelos e normas de qualidade de software foram criados a fim de atender plenamente os requisitos de qualidade auxiliando na melhoria dos processos internos e promovendo a normatização de produtos e serviços. A implantação de um programa de qualidade começa pela definição e implantação do processo de software documentado onde estabeleçam as atividades a serem realizadas durante o processo, sua estrutura e organização, artefatos requeridos, produzidos e recursos necessários (humanos, hardware e software) para a realização das atividades. Sobre o modelo de qualidade de software Norma ISO/IEC 12207 marque à alternativa INCORRETA.
Alternativas
Q1919446 Arquitetura de Computadores
A figura a seguir mostra a estrutura de um computador.
Imagem associada para resolução da questão
http://www.telecom.uff.br/orgarqcomp/arq/arquitetura-e-organizacaocomputadores-8a.pdf
De acordo com a figura, analise as afirmativas. 
I. A memória principal também é conhecida como memória central, é uma memória de rápido acesso e que armazena os dados/informações (programas, objetos, dados de entrada e saída, dados do sistema operacional, etc.).
II. CPU é a sigla em inglês para Unidade Central de Processamento, o componente do computador que concentra todas as principais operações que permitem a seu PC, celular, tablet ou videogame a funcionar. Não é exagero, portanto, se referir à CPU como o “cérebro” desses dispositivos.
III. Chamamos de dispositivos de entrada e saída os dispositivos encarregados de incorporar e extrair informação de um computador. Eles se enquadram dentro da denominada: Arquitetura de Von Neumann, que explica as principais partes de um computador.
Estão corretas as afirmativas:
Alternativas
Q1919444 Arquitetura de Computadores
Tanto a estrutura quanto o funcionamento de um computador são, essencialmente, simples. A figura abaixo representa as funções básicas que um computador pode realizar. 
Imagem associada para resolução da questão
http://www.telecom.uff.br/orgarqcomp/arq/arquitetura-e-organizacaocomputadores-8a.pdf 

NÃO é uma função básica que um computador pode realizar:
Alternativas
Q1919443 Sistemas Operacionais
De acordo com Negus (2015), o sistema de arquivos Linux é a estrutura na qual todas as informações do sistema são armazenadas. De fato, uma das propriedades que definem o sistema UNIX, no qual o Linux é baseado, é que quase tudo que se precisa identificar em um sistema (dados, comandos, links simbólicos, dispositivos e diretórios) é representado por itens nos arquivos.

Imagem associada para resolução da questão
Fonte: NEGUS, Christopher. Linux Bible. 9a Edição. Indianapolis, USA. Wiley, 2015. 
Neste contexto e considerando a imagem apresentada, julgue as proposições e marque (V) para verdadeiro ou, (F) para falso.
(  ) Nesta imagem, utilizou-se o comando "df -h" no no terminal para verificar sobre o sistema de arquivos de um determinado usuário linux.
(  ) O rootfs é o sistema de arquivo inicial do Linux. Pode ser um arquivo cpio/etx2 (comum em aplicações embarcadas), uma partição (geralmente sistemas não embarcados) ou ainda via rede (NFS, por exemplo).
(  ) O sistema rootfs deste usuário possui aproximadamente 8G de espaço. 
(  ) O sistema rootfs também desempenha a função de usuário administrador.

A sequência correta é:
Alternativas
Q1919442 Sistemas Operacionais
Um sistema Linux embarcado não se difere, no quesito sistêmico, de um sistema Linux desktop. A mesma estrutura e conceitos são aplicados em ambos os domínios. A principal diferença está nos requisitos de processamento, armazenamento, consumo de energia e confiabilidade. Na maioria dos sistemas Linux embarcado, os recursos disponíveis são limitados e muitas vezes a interface com usuário é bastante limitada ou simplesmente não existe. Neste contexto, complete as lacunas a seguir. 
De acordo com Sobell (2008), a linguagem padrão para o desenvolvimento de aplicações no nível do sistema é a __________, estando a __________ padrão sempre presente em sistemas Linux. Quando se requer um nível maior de abstração, a __________ ou __________ também podem ser uma boa escolha. Linguagens de script, como __________ e __________ são muito úteis em determinadas tarefas, e podem ajudar a diminuir o tempo de desenvolvimento, sem deixar de considerar questões como o consumo de recursos e a segurança da aplicação e do sistema. 
Marque a alternativa que completa corretamente as lacunas. 
Alternativas
Q1919439 Banco de Dados
A Oracle surpreendeu o mercado, ao anunciar o primeiro banco de dados autônomo. Baseado em técnicas de machine learning, o grande objetivo do sistema é eliminar a atuação de seres humanos, o que, segundo a empresa, reduz para praticamente zero as chances de erros. Mas a questão que fica é: qual o futuro da profissão de DBA (Database Administrator – Administrador de Banco de Dados)? Este profissional é o responsável pela gestão dos dados das organizações. A partir deste cenário, avalie as afirmações seguintes sobre as funções de um profissional DBA, assinalando (V) para afirmações verdadeiras e (F) para afirmações falsas.
(  ) Manutenção de rotina: liberar espaços no servidor, realizar backup e monitorar as tarefas no servidor (evitando possíveis gargalos de acessos); 
(   ) Concessão de autorização ao acesso aos dados: define quem pode visualizar determinada informação no banco, estabelece juntamente com os administradores da empresa, quais os dados que cada usuário comum poderá ter acesso; 
(   ) Definição do esquema: é o DBA que cria, modifica e atualiza o esquema do banco de dados, executando um conjunto de instruções;
(   ) Redução dos custos para a empresa, o melhor atendimento do cliente (satisfação do cliente) e agilidade no processo decisório.

Assinale a sequência correta.
Alternativas
Q1919438 Banco de Dados
O conceito de transação é fundamental para muitas aplicações de banco de dados.Uma transação é uma visão abstrata que o SGBD tem de um programa de usuário: uma seqüência de leituras (reads) e escritas (writes). A partir deste cenário e dos seus conhecimentos sobre SGBD, avalie as seguintes asserções: 
I. A execução concorrente de programas usuário é essencial para o bom desempenho de um SGBD. 
PORQUE
II. Como os acessos a disco são frequentes, e relativamente lentos, é importante manter a CPU trabalhando em vários programas usuários concorrentemente.

Assinale a alternativa correta:
Alternativas
Q1919437 Banco de Dados
Um SGBD (Sistema de Gerenciamento de Banco de Dados) é um conjunto de softwares que possuem a finalidade de gerenciar as informações de um banco de dados (também conhecida como base de dados). Devem organizar, acessar, controlar e dar proteção às informações contidas no banco de dados. Tem por objetivo facilitar a vida do programador ou analista, deixando livre para pensar na modelagem e não ficar pensando em questões técnicas de armazenamento de dados (sendo uma das funções do SGBD). A partir deste cenário, sobre os requisitos de um SGDB é correto afirmar que:
Alternativas
Q1919076 Algoritmos e Estrutura de Dados
Considere as afirmativas a seguir sobre estrutura de dados:
I. Uma estrutura de dados heterogênea envolve a utilização de mais de um tipo básico de dado.
II. Uma lista encadeada pode ser definida como uma sequência de células em que cada célula contém um elemento e o endereço da célula seguinte.
III. Uma pilha é uma estrutura de dados baseada no princípio “First In First Out” (FIFO).
IV. Filas e pilhas são estruturas de dados lineares; o organograma de uma empresa pode ser representado por uma estrutura de árvore.
Está CORRETO o que se afirma, apenas, em:
Alternativas
Q1919075 Engenharia de Software
Considere as afirmativas a seguir com relação à orientação a objetos:
I. Abstração, Encapsulamento, Herança e Polimorfismo são pilares do paradigma de orientação a objetos.
II. Classe abstrata é uma classe que não é instanciada; apenas fornece um modelo para geração de outras classes.
III. Generalização é a técnica utilizada para esconder detalhes internos (atributos/métodos) de uma classe.
IV. Herança múltipla ocorre quando mais de um método é herdado.
Está CORRETO o que se afirma, apenas, em:
Alternativas
Q1919073 Algoritmos e Estrutura de Dados
Analise as expressões lógicas. O símbolo % representa resto de divisão inteira:
I. falso ou ( 10 % 5 * 2 <> 5 * 2 + 1 )
II. não falso e ( 3 * 3 / 3 < 15 − 5 % 7)
III. p e (q ou r) quando p é verdade, q é falso e r é falso
IV. ((34 < 9) e (5 + u = 34)) ou ((5 = 15/3) e (8 > 12)), onde u = 29
Assinale a alternativa que apresenta CORRETAMENTE os resultados de tais expressões lógicas: 
Alternativas
Q1919072 Engenharia de Software
Considere as afirmativas a seguir, relativas ao Modelo Conceitual de um sistema modelado na linguagem UML:
I. O Modelo Conceitual deve descrever a informação que o sistema vai gerenciar. Trata-se de um artefato do domínio do problema, e não do domínio da solução.
II. Esse modelo não deve ser confundido com o modelo de dados, pois o modelo de dados enfatiza a representação e organização dos dados armazenados, já o modelo conceitual, a compreensão da informação.
III. Os conceitos nesse modelo são representados por Classes. As informações diretamente ligadas aos conceitos são chamadas de Atributos e o relacionamento entre classes são as Associações.
Está CORRETO o que se afirma em:
Alternativas
Q1919071 Engenharia de Software
Considere as afirmativas a seguir em relação à linguagem UML:
I. Os diagramas da linguagem possibilitam representar visões distintas do sistema.
II. “Cadastrar cliente”, “Registrar pagamento de fatura” e “Ser compatível com Linux” são requisitos funcionais de um sistema de gerenciamento de vendas e, portanto, podem ser representados como Casos de Uso.
III. O diagrama de sequência pode ser útil para representar a sequência de eventos em um cenário de caso de uso.
IV. As linhas horizontais em um diagrama de sequência representam o fluxo da informação que pode ocorrer entre atores, de atores para o sistema e do sistema para os atores.
Está CORRETO o que se afirma em: 
Alternativas
Q1919070 Engenharia de Software
Considere as afirmativas a seguir:
I. Colaboração com o cliente e resposta rápida às mudanças estão entre os principais valores do manifesto ágil.
II. SCRUM é um framework para gerenciamento de projetos e pode ser adotado por empresas certificadas em modelos de melhoria de processo como o MPS-Br.
III. Um dos principais objetivos do processo GRE em uma empresa nível G do MPS-Br é que ela gerencie as mudanças nos requisitos do software.
IV. Os modelos de processo de desenvolvimento de software da abordagem interativa e incremental tendem a facilitar a adaptação às constantes mudanças nos requisitos do software.
Está CORRETO o que se afirma em:
Alternativas
Q1919069 Engenharia de Software
Considere as afirmativas a seguir em relação à Engenharia de Software:
I. Requisitos funcionais são as declarações de serviços que o sistema deve fornecer e requisitos nãofuncionais referem-se às propriedades emergentes, bem como às restrições sobre tal sistema.
II. O estudo de viabilidade é uma atividade que integra o processo de engenharia de requisitos.
III. As políticas de rastreabilidade são fundamentais no gerenciamento de requisitos.
IV. Os requisitos do sistema não são afetados por fatores organizacionais.
Está CORRETO o que se afirma, apenas, em: 
Alternativas
Q1919064 Banco de Dados
Considere as afirmativas a seguir, relativas ao Modelo Entidade-Relacionamento:
I. Relacionamentos do tipo N:N correspondem a um tipo especial de relacionamento no qual as entidades que se relacionam pertencem ao mesmo conjunto de entidades.
II. Relacionamentos do tipo 1:N indicam que uma entidade em A está associada a várias entidades em B. Uma entidade em B, entretanto, deve estar associada, no máximo, a uma entidade em A.
III. Relacionamentos ternários são relacionamentos especiais do tipo 1:N, nos quais a cardinalidade máxima N é igual a 3.
Está CORRETO o que se afirma em:
Alternativas
Q1919063 Engenharia de Software
Considere as afirmativas a seguir:
I. Inteligência Artificial (IA) é a parte da Ciência da Computação que se destina a desenvolver sistemas capazes de resolver um problema de uma maneira tal que seja considerada inteligente quando executada por um ser humano.
II. Redes Neurais é uma técnica de IA que utiliza redes de computadores interconectados em núcleos neurais.
III. A computação cognitiva, baseada em redes neurais e deep learning, está aplicando conhecimento de ciências cognitivas para desenvolver sistemas que simulem processos do pensamento humano.
IV. Para provar que é inteligente pelo teste de Turing, um sistema (máquina) deve se comportar como um ser humano.
Está CORRETO o que se afirma, apenas, em:
Alternativas
Q1919062 Banco de Dados
Assinale a afirmativa INCORRETA: 
Alternativas
Q1919061 Administração Pública
De acordo com a LGPD (Lei Geral de Proteção de Dados), NÃO é um direito do titular dos dados pessoais: 
Alternativas
Respostas
601: A
602: B
603: C
604: B
605: E
606: A
607: E
608: D
609: A
610: C
611: B
612: B
613: D
614: C
615: D
616: C
617: B
618: D
619: C
620: D